Which brings me to my next point, it’s integration with Call to Arms, Barbed Wire studios used to post game updates on their Facebook page early in development and at some point when they were nearing the end of development Best Way who created the GEM engine basically said that they were no longer allowed to release a standalone game using the GEM2 engine and they had internal discussions to either shift development to a different engine or find another way to licence it, that’s why it’s integrated with Call to Arms because Digitalmindsoft already had a licence and they came together to solve the issue. Also Robz is actually now a developer on Gates of Hell too which is why the mod is now rarely updated. I just completed MoW2AS and currently playing the basic CtA.
I prefer the mechanic, gameplay and hotkeys of MoW2AS than CtA.
In MoW2AS, i can completely fix any broken abandoned vehicles especially armor vehicle. In CtA i havent able to stun then capture / steal armored vehicle.
In MoW2AS i able to lift and hide enemy dead bodies easily. I csnt do that in CtA.
No hotkey to craw/laydown troops in CtA.
In MoW2AS i can pick up any dropped weaponary, especially AT bazooka. In CtA sometimes the troops cant pick it.
In MoW2AS we can call any invantery/cavalery/altillery/support reinforcements when having sufficient "morale"
The CtA FPV just nice to have, since the main reason playing RTS, player is focusing on map view

As a player of MOWAS2, CTA, GOH with over a thousand hours combined (MOWAS2 having the most), Gates of hell in all honnesty. Has the better controls, gameplay, graohics, style, sounds etc. etc. Like legit who know dragging your soilders silouties on cover would spread them our. Its super useful and it often sucks goin bsck to cta or as2. But it has no where near the mod support of men of war assault squad two. If i wanna boot up a cold war mod i only so far have hot mod. In mowas2 i have red frog, project twilight (if i remember the name) and orher various while cancled still there mods (valour cold war). Modern day as well from Red Rising to Modern Warfare. Mowas2 also has mods like robz, valour or world at war introducing even more niche nations into the game. By comparasion valour for gates of hell adds 3 small factions and the french and british and japanese. Pretty unfortunate considering two of those were base game for mowas2 and the others being poland, italy and Hungary while super fun to play tend to wear out. Men of War Assault Squad 2 has the most content, but it's only available as a 32 bit client, meaning it can't use more than 4 gb of ram resulting in limited moddability. So there's one game left, and it's Gates of Hell.
